HourCast To Release State Of Disgrace On Alkamedia
Records Album In Stores June 20th, 2006




Heavy music is often the result of deep emotions. Sadness, frustration and anger combined with a musician’s talent can result in music which is awesomely powerful, uniquely deep, and thought-provoking. Such is the case with HourCast.

Born out of Boston, Massachusetts, HourCast combines elements of hard rock and metal with a distinct electronic influence. “We had no preconceptions as to what the band would sound like,” says vocalist Patrick McBride. The members of HourCast – Mcbride, drummer Jerry Clews, guitarist David Henriquez and bassist David Sullivan - have combined
their varied influences to create a unique sound that
incorporates the heavy flavor of Deftones and Tool with the dark electronic atmosphere of Nine Inch Nails and Depeche Mode.

The somber tones of State Of Disgrace are a result of these efforts.From the introspective opening track “This Life”, to “Freeze” (which McBride describes as an “epic, desperate
song”) State Of Disgrace has a cold, sharp intensity. The self-loathing “Smash Up” eschews a bitter tone, while “Lunar” tells a tale of longing and loneliness. “The music and lyrics are a reflection of what was going on at the time,” explains
McBride. “I found myself in a new environment and was going through a big change in my life and that comes out in the songs.” State Of Disgrace will be available at iTunes on May 2nd and
in stores on June 20th, 2006.

Not being signed to a label could serve as a liability to some bands, but not HourCast. “We didn’t have a label telling us what to do and that allowed us to add variety and flavor to the album,” says McBride. HourCast is a band looking to gain ground in the current music scene. “Myspace and live shows are definitely helping us to build a fan base,” says McBride.
